Parker Meggitt
, a recent addition to Parker Hannifin, is a global leader in the Commercial and Military Aerospace markets, specializing in a wide range of products including fire and smoke detection systems, extinguishing systems, bleed air overheat detection systems, actuators, rudder pedal assemblies, pumps, fuel gauging systems, and high-temperature cables. Located in Simi Valley, CA, this site is within the Fire Safety & Power Systems Division (FSPSD) and is a key supplier in select energy markets, particularly in nuclear gas analyzers and nuclear containment vessel penetration cables.

We work directly with some of the largest aerospace companies in the world, including Airbus, Boeing, Embraer, and Lockheed Martin, among others.

Embedded Software Engineer 2

JOB DESIGNATION

Embedded Software Engineer 2 designs, develops and debugs software, working in small teams to solve problems and explore technologies for new and existing core products.

Responsibilities
  • Captures, decomposes and derives functional requirements to develop technical specifications.
  • Applies software standards and utilizes specifications to design, develop, integrate and test safety-critical software applications using standard and model-based development methodologies and tools.
  • Authors design documentation and develop drivers for embedded devices, including microcontrollers and associated peripherals.
  • Perform, track and control internal project activities and manage external sub-contractors (including offshore verification partners). Support other members of the team with knowledge of best practices and safety-critical development. Creates periodical status reports for key functions.
  • Identify continuous improvement opportunities, including standardization of tools and processes.
  • Works as part of a software engineering team using source control concepts.
  • Consistent exercise of independent judgment and discretion in matters of significance.
Qualifications
  • Experience using C at a low level (microcontrollers, drivers, interacting with hardware, etc…)
  • Experience with Software verification of embedded systems
  • Experience with Version Control and Configuration Management systems
  • Experience with System verification using lab equipment - oscilloscopes, multimeters, etc…
  • Ideally, Aerospace Software Engineering Compliance with DO-178B/C, SOI Audit experience
  • Ability to solve problems using a systematic and analytical approach
  • Fundamental knowledge of engineering domain principles, concepts, and techniques
  • Good oral and written communication skills
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office
Education & Experience
  • A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ering or Science Technical discipline is required -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ineer, Computer Science, etc…
  • 3+ years minimum experience
